I used Saunders to help review content. I did many, many Saunders questions. However, I think that my Kaplan course was so much more helpful in terms of the style of questions presented. They were written much more like the actual exam questions than the Saunder's questions were. I think that Lippencott is also kinda similar to Saunder's. Kaplan also has a money-back guarantee and I believe that they have both online and actual physical classes.

saunders (content)........kaplan(questions)

i totally agree. the rationales on saunders are unbeatable and an excellent tool for review but the questions are too easy. kaplan makes you think through the questions, but the rationales don't give enough information like saunders does.
